He’ll Never Let Go My Hand

Author: Maggie E. Gregory Appears in 8 hymnals First Line: My blessed Savior holds my hand Lyrics: 1 My blessed Savior holds my hand, And leads me day by day; He knows the dangers of the land, For he has passed this way. Refrain: He’ll never let go my hand He’ll never let go my hand, I love him so, and he loves me; I know, He’ll never let go my hand. 2 My blessed Savior holds my hand, And he will guide aright; While I obey his blest command My path is crowned with light. [Refrain] 3 My blessed Savior holds my hand, A tender guide is he; He’ll lead me to the glory-land Beyond the silent sea. [Refrain] 4 So, while my Savior holds my hand, I cannot go astray; With him I’ll walk the golden strand Of everlasting day. [Refrain] Used With Tune: [My blessed Savior holds my hand]

Chas. H. Gabriel

1856 - 1932 Composer of "[My blessed Savior holds my hand]" in Songs of Revival Power Pseudonyms: C. D. Emerson, Charlotte G. Homer, S. B. Jackson, A. W. Lawrence, Jennie Ree ============= For the first seventeen years of his life Charles Hutchinson Gabriel (b. Wilton, IA, 1856; d. Los Angeles, CA, 1932) lived on an Iowa farm, where friends and neighbors often gathered to sing. Gabriel accompanied them on the family reed organ he had taught himself to play. At the age of sixteen he began teaching singing in schools (following in his father's footsteps) and soon was acclaimed as a fine teacher and composer. He moved to California in 1887 and served as Sunday school music director at the Grace Methodist Church in San Francisco. After moving to Chicago in 1892, Gabriel edited numerous collections of anthems, cantatas, and a large number of songbooks for the Homer Rodeheaver, Hope, and E. O. Excell publishing companies. He composed hundreds of tunes and texts, at times using pseudonyms such as Charlotte G. Homer. The total number of his compositions is estimated at about seven thousand. Gabriel's gospel songs became widely circulated through the Billy Sunday­-Homer Rodeheaver urban crusades. Bert Polman
